To verify that the web console is installed correctly, use the master host name and the console port number to access the console with a web browser.

For example, for a master host with a hostname of `master.openshift.com` and using the default port of `8443`, the web console would be found at:

----
https://master.openshift.com:8443/console
----

// end::verifying-the-installation[]

[NOTE]
====
The default port for the console is `8443`. If this was changed during the installation, the port can be found at *openshift_master_console_port* in the *_/etc/ansible/hosts_* file.
